WitrynaNewspapers and news media in the United States traditionally endorse candidates for party nomination for President of the United States, prior to endorsing one of the … WitrynaNewspapers endorsing candidates running for national or local seats in the US is a phenomenon many Europe-based journalists find bizarre. While European papers will definitely have a general “bias” or slant for a certain candidate, especially when it reflects their general editorial opinion – this bias is only seen between the lines and does not … customer service time warner https://amgassociates.net

Witryna13 lip 2024 · Endorsing candidates at the state level creates complications as well. State legislators make decisions that impact cities on a regular basis, and complicating those relationships is unnecessary.
